If … In solid-waste management: Composition and properties Refuse includes garbage and rubbish. Garbage is mostly decomposable food waste; rubbish is mostly dry material such as glass, paper, cloth, or wood. Proper siting of refuse piles, construction of subdrains to maintain embankment stability and to reduce water in the pile’s foundation, diversion of natural runoff, and provisions for sedimentation of silt in runoff are examples of management techniques now being used in association with refuse disposal.
